How to Fix d3dcompiler_43.dll is missing error in Zombie Army 4: Dead War
Download & install DirectX
DirectX is a bunch of APIs mixed together that handle multimedia related tasks such as playing high fi video games, video and 3D content. One of the basic steps to fix d3dcompiler_43.dll is missing error in Zombie Army 4: Dead War is to just download and install the version of DirectX that is required by Zombie Army 4: Dead War.
Typically, DirectX 9 or 11 do just fine for most video games.
